An open API service indexing awesome lists of open source software.

Socket.IO

Socket.IO is a JavaScript library for realtime web applications. It enables realtime, bi-directional communication between web clients and servers. It has two parts: a client-side library that runs in the browser, and a server-side library for Node.js. Both components have a nearly identical API. Like Node.js, it is event-driven.

https://github.com/pavankalyan-nvs/simple-chat-app

A basic chat application using Node.js and Socket.io. The app allows users to connect to a common chat room and exchange messages in real time, enabling seamless communication between multiple users.

chat-app chat-application socket-io socket-programming

Last synced: 03 Feb 2026

https://github.com/kostastepetes/burnerchat-video-call-web-app

🎦 Video Call Web App called BurnerChat. Completely safe and private video call using of unique call ID that you send to a peer and do a 1-to-1 call. Made with nodeJS + Express + ReactJS + MaterialUI + WebRTC + Socket.io

cors express material-ui nodejs react socket-io video-chat-app video-chat-meetings webrtc

Last synced: 27 Feb 2025

https://github.com/rohan1279/shop-adidas

This is a MERN stack e-commerce project built with React.js, Tailwind CSS and Firebase. It utilizes the Google Drive API for image storage, allowing sellers to upload their product images. The UI features a modern Neumorphism design and adapts based on user roles.

firebase-auth googledriveapi mongodb neumorphic-design reactjs socket-io tailwindcss

Last synced: 09 Apr 2025

https://github.com/amovah/chat-socket-react

a example for using react and express together

express jwt react react-router-v4 redux socket-io webpack

Last synced: 11 Apr 2026

https://github.com/miladjoodi/realtime_room_websocket_webrtc

RealTime Room - WebSocket & WebRTC is a platform enabling video calls, audio, and text transfer within shared rooms. It uses WebSocket for instant messaging and room management and leverages WebRTC for peer-to-peer video/audio connections. 🚀 The project will continue to evolve with more details and features added

nextjs peer-to-peer react realtime socket socket-io tailwind typescript videocalls webrtc websocket

Last synced: 01 Mar 2025

https://github.com/rwubakwanayo/edumeet

EduMeet: A virtual meeting web app focusing on comprehensive participant engagement tracking, including monitoring when users join and leave meetings, frequency of muting video or audio, screen sharing activities, recording sessions, and more.

mongodb nodejs reactjs socket-io tailwindcss typescript

Last synced: 26 Apr 2025

https://github.com/mlatka9/chat-app

Full-stack chat application

express firebase mongodb react socket-io

Last synced: 11 Feb 2026

https://github.com/ramyhakam/zteam-chat

Z-Team Chat is a free and open source Chat Web App Just For learning propose

angular-cli angular4 express nodejs socket-io

Last synced: 02 Aug 2025

https://github.com/nivindulakshitha/socket-server

Simple Node JS socket connection

nodejs socket-io

Last synced: 30 Jan 2026

https://github.com/anchovycation/pingu-front-end

The best way to watch YouTube by video chatting with friends.

chat react reactjs socket-io video-chat webrtc youtube

Last synced: 01 Aug 2025

https://github.com/fdhhhdjd/chat-app-real-time-fullstack

ReactJs,Redux,Nodejs,MongoDb,Socket.io,docker,Deploy:Heroky,Netlify

docker heroku-deployment nodejs reactjs redux socket-io

Last synced: 06 Mar 2026

https://github.com/binaryb3ast/playsho-nest

This repository contains the backend codebase for the PlaySho Android app, built with NestJS , MongoDb , Socket.IO

js mongodb nestjs socket-io typescript

Last synced: 19 Mar 2025

https://github.com/mediacomem/one-chat-room

Real-time Node.js/Vue/Socket.io demo application

chat chatroom node nodejs real-time realtime socket-io socketio vue vuejs

Last synced: 04 Apr 2025

https://github.com/jungdu/rtc-socket-connector-client

A library on the client-side for establishing WebRTC connection.

socket-io typescript webrtc

Last synced: 02 Sep 2025

https://github.com/hoangtran0410/caro-p5js

Create rooms and play Caro with your friends

heroku-deployment nodejs online-game p5js socket-io

Last synced: 31 Jul 2025

https://github.com/payalkumari10/realtime_tracker

The Realtime Device Tracker is a dynamic web application that allows users to track device locations in real-time. Built with Node.js, Express, and Socket.IO, this project leverages the power of WebSockets for real-time communication,.

express geolocation leaflet nodejs socket-io

Last synced: 05 Nov 2025

https://github.com/arturnawrot/chickenpoll

Web application for creating real time straw polls. Stack: Laravel 5.7, MySQL, Bootstrap 4, Vue.js, socket.io, redis

bootstrap4 laravel5 mysql php redis scss socket-io straw-polls vuejs2

Last synced: 27 Oct 2025

https://github.com/iamsdas/whiteboard

Collaborative whiteboard app using vuejs and socket.io

canvas drawing socket-io vue vuejs whiteboard

Last synced: 26 Jul 2025

https://github.com/zenxen7/wildchats

WildChats is a real-time chat application built for Cebu Institute of Technology - University (CIT-U) students, also known as Wildcats!

daisyui mern reactjs socket-io

Last synced: 27 Jul 2025

https://github.com/diegothucao/docker-socketio-nodejs

This is an essential example to build docker with Composer, Express and Socket IO

chat docker es6 essential express javascript nginx nodejs pm2 socket-io template

Last synced: 11 Apr 2025

https://github.com/amnuts/luther-escape-room

Escape Room Terminal: socket.io control of videos/audio on html canvas

escape-room express-js html5-audio html5-video node socket-io

Last synced: 26 Jul 2025

https://github.com/akhilsharmaa/rocket-typing-multiplayer-game

The Multiplayer Typing WebApp is a real-time game where users compete by typing words, facilitated by Socket.io for seamless communication.

css ejs-express html javascript node socket-io websocket

Last synced: 24 Apr 2025

https://github.com/alexcambose/phaser-and-socket.io-multimplayer-game

A simple Phaser and Socket.io game based on websockets for multiplayer support :video_game:

es6 game multiplayer phaserjs socket-io websockets

Last synced: 14 Apr 2026

https://github.com/joway/socket.io-kfk

Kafka adapter for socket.io

adapter kafka socket-io

Last synced: 11 Apr 2025

https://github.com/bahirabdulla/vision

It is MERN stack project Online mentorship platform in micro-service architecture by following controller-service-repository pattern

controller-service-repository docker dockerfile ingress-nginx k8s mern-project microservice-architecture rabbit socket-io tailwindcss typescript webrtc

Last synced: 30 Oct 2025

https://github.com/ghostwriternr/dbmsass3

Studious - A Course management system :mortar_board: :orange_book: :boy: :girl:

angularjs cms mongo nodejs socket-io

Last synced: 24 Jul 2025

https://github.com/socketio/socket.io-aws-sqs-adapter

The Socket.IO adapter for AWS Simple Queue Service (SQS), allowing to broadcast events between several Socket.IO servers.

aws aws-sqs socket-io

Last synced: 19 Oct 2025

https://github.com/staghouse/windfish-app

Windfish.io is a Node Server/Client built in Nuxt/Vue and uses WebSockets and a Twitch chat bot to track game play while playing LADX Randomizer

discord-bot legend-of-zelda socket-io vue

Last synced: 22 Feb 2026

https://github.com/bgunson/obd-socketio

python-OBD ASGI and JSON serializer

asgi json obd2 socket-io websocket

Last synced: 11 Apr 2025

https://github.com/codeantik/react-chat-app

A responsive web chat app where users can make rooms and chat.

emoji express nodejs react socket-io

Last synced: 10 Apr 2025

https://github.com/lelserslasers/multiboard

Easy to use real-time multi-user online whiteboard

express itch-io nodejs realtime socket-io whiteboard

Last synced: 24 Feb 2026

https://github.com/jeremytubongbanua/bailey-x-twitch

Alerts on my twitch channel will activate water pump to water my plant, Bailey. Powered by a raspberry pi hosting a web server to communicate across my home router.

flask node-js raspberry-pi socket-io ssh

Last synced: 07 Feb 2026

https://github.com/saracalihan/pingu

Best way to chat and talk with friends while watch YouTube

chat nodejs reactjs socket-io websocket

Last synced: 15 Mar 2025

https://github.com/tnmyk/chatrooms-using-socket-io

Create and join custom chatrooms. Share text and images. Made using Socket.io, Chakra UI, React.js etc.

chakra-ui expressjs react socket-io

Last synced: 26 May 2026

https://github.com/articulate/sox

Our super-special sockets stuff

javascript redux socket-io

Last synced: 13 Apr 2025

https://github.com/ali-raza764/chess-pro

A chess app made using nextjs 14

chess chess-api nextjs14 puzzles reactjs socket-io stockfish

Last synced: 30 Apr 2025

https://github.com/vaishali31verma/chat-app

Group chat is similar to chat features in that it gives you the ability to send instant messages to others in an organization. More specifically, group chat is the ability to chat with multiple people. Using a secure group chat platform, teams within your business can dynamically share information and ideas.

chat chat-application javascript nodejs react react-js reactjs socket-io

Last synced: 27 Jun 2025

https://github.com/rafiulgits/node-interview-chat

A chat application to take coding interview with interactive conversation

chat-application express interview socket-io

Last synced: 11 Mar 2026

https://github.com/socketio/socket.io-azure-service-bus-adapter

The Socket.IO adapter for Azure Service Bus, allowing to broadcast events between several Socket.IO servers.

azure azure-service-bus socket-io

Last synced: 19 Oct 2025

https://github.com/davanesh/uber_clone

A fully functional Uber clone built with React Native for the mobile interface and Node.js for the backend. Features include user authentication, ride booking, real-time tracking, driver profiles, payment integration, and push notifications. Firebase is used for authentication and real-time database management.

android-app chat-application cross-platform expressjs google-maps-api ios-app mapbox nodejs postgresql react-native socket-io

Last synced: 15 Apr 2025

https://github.com/abdelrhmanfdl/nim-game-multiplayer

nim game app gives the ability to establish a game between two players

express mongodb nim-game nodejs reactjs socket-io

Last synced: 28 Jan 2026

https://github.com/jroliveira/planning-poker-api

A Planning Poker (api)(🃏) powered by Koa and Socket.IO.

babeljs es7 javascript koa2 mongodb nodejs socket-io web-api

Last synced: 17 Feb 2026

https://github.com/collins87mbathi/realtime_blog_api

This is an API of a Realtime blog application having MySQL as the database

expressjs mysql nodejs sequelizejs socket-io

Last synced: 08 Jul 2025

https://github.com/hesbon-osoro/snappy-server

Snappy Chat App using React, Node.js, Express, Socket.io, and MongoDB (Server)

express localstorage mongodb node react socket-io

Last synced: 06 Apr 2026

https://github.com/sanidhyy/chat-app

Snappy is a Realtime React JS Chat Application using Socket.io and MongoDb

chat-application javascript js mongodb mongoose react react-router-dom reactjs socket-io

Last synced: 05 Sep 2025

https://github.com/adelpro/socketio-auth

Implement User/Password Authentication in Socket.IO and ReactJS In this project we will use ReactJS to build an authentication system to secure Socket.IO access.

nodejs react realtime socket-io

Last synced: 30 Apr 2025

https://github.com/sanjeev662/clone-chat-app

This MERN chat app encompasses key features: user authorization, one-to-one/group chat, and real-time communication via Socket.IO, ensuring dynamic and seamless interactions for users.

chakra-ui chat-application mern-stack socket-io

Last synced: 22 Feb 2026

https://github.com/vikashanandjha/hannah

Free Virtual meeting Like Google Meet.

nextjs react reactjs socket-io socketio webrtc websocket

Last synced: 02 May 2025

https://github.com/lludol/socket-io-tester

A simple application to test sockets from socket.io.

socket socket-io socket-io-tester test-socket

Last synced: 23 Apr 2025

https://github.com/nhviet03/mobile-app_social_network

Building a Full Stack Social Network Mobile App with React Native using Redux, MongoDB, Expo Router, NodeJS, and TailwindCSS.

expo expressjs mongodb nodejs react react-native redux socket-io tailwind-css

Last synced: 17 Jul 2025

https://github.com/saketkothari/video-call-webapp

A video chat application developed with React.js, WebRTC, and Socket.io.

copy-to-clipboard material-ui nodejs peer-to-peer reactjs socket-io webrtc

Last synced: 04 Sep 2025

https://github.com/powerumc/xterm-addon-attach-socketio

xterm.js attach by socket.io

attach socket-io xterm

Last synced: 20 Mar 2025

https://github.com/cheton/react-webapp-base

Building a complete web application with React

express react redux sagas socket-io

Last synced: 08 Apr 2026

https://github.com/surelle-ha/redsocket

RedSocket is event-driven platform for real-time web applications that uses Redis Sub/Pub Technology. It acts as middleware that enables real-time communication between web clients and servers securely.

javascript realtime saas socket-io

Last synced: 23 Oct 2025

https://github.com/anamritraj/spot-connect

Real time history of songs played by me on Spotify.

mongodb mongoose nodejs real-time socket-io spotify-playlist spotify-web-api

Last synced: 10 Apr 2026

https://github.com/leroyalle/chime-backend

Backend for a social network app handling authentication, user management, real-time chat, news feed, likes, and comments.

nestjs postgresql prisma socket-io

Last synced: 06 Mar 2026

https://github.com/sebastianwachter/collaborativewhiteboard

Socket.io based collaborative whiteboard using a express server.

canvas nodejs pug-template-engine socket-io

Last synced: 15 Apr 2025

https://github.com/patrickhollweck/srocket

A socket.io framework focusing on type-safety

framework nodejs socket-io typescript typescript-library web websocket

Last synced: 23 Apr 2025

https://github.com/xrystalll/gochat_2

Chat app built with nodejs, socket.io and mongodb

chat cloud-db express jquery mongodb mongoose multer nodejs socket-io voice-messages

Last synced: 23 Apr 2025

https://github.com/super3/nile.chat

A chat for communities.

chat community nodejs redis socket-io

Last synced: 09 Apr 2025

https://github.com/jungdu/rtc-socket-connector-server

A library on the server-side for establishing WebRTC connection.

express nodejs socket-io webrtc

Last synced: 12 Oct 2025

https://github.com/p2js/lemonchat

Socket.io based chat app with some neat extra features.

chat chatroom html html-css-javascript node-js nodejs socket-io socketio

Last synced: 25 Feb 2026

https://github.com/mizuka-wu/excalidraw-yjs-starter

A lightweight collaborative drawing platform built with Excalidraw, Next.js, YJS and Socket.IO, enabling real-time whiteboard collaboration with persistent storage capabilities.

collaboration docker docker-compose excalidraw nextjs self-hosted socket-io yjs

Last synced: 08 Apr 2026

https://github.com/villy-p/instant-messaging-app

A small instant messaging app using Vue and SocketJS for hosting on a local server

instant-messaging messaging-app socket-io vue

Last synced: 19 Mar 2025

https://github.com/abdatta/bulls-eye

A reactive UI for bull queue with sockets for realtime updates.

bull bull-queue hacktoberfest rxjs socket-io

Last synced: 10 Sep 2025

https://github.com/prititi/fun-note-365-

Easy polls is the ultimate Q&A and polling platform for live and virtual meetings and events and it is a clone of slido.

bcyrpt css expressjs html javascript jwt-authentication mongodb nodejs socket-io ws

Last synced: 13 Oct 2025

https://github.com/iamlizu/sockmanage

🔌 Manage single active WebSocket connections per user with Redis-powered persistence.

redis socket-io websockets

Last synced: 23 Apr 2025

https://github.com/antoninobonanno/express-startup-project

Quick Start Project is a Node.js server based on the Express framework and MySQL database. In this project we define an elegant and intuitive project structure, able to separate the correct responsibilities between the files...

docker docker-compose dotenv express express-validator keycloak morgan mysql nodejs nodejs-server prisma socket-io typescript winston

Last synced: 23 Apr 2025

https://github.com/aaron5670/simple-realtime-phaser-3-platformer

🕹️ Simple realtime platform game build with Phaser 3, Socket.io, ExpressJS & Webpack 4.

expressjs multiplayer-browser-game multiplayer-game multiplayer-web-game phaser phaser-framework phaser3 socket socket-io webpack

Last synced: 13 Jul 2025

https://github.com/thejasnu/video-chat-web-app

Video chat app built using React, Socket.io and WebRTC

material-ui reactjs socket-io webrtc

Last synced: 02 Nov 2025

https://github.com/safakb/socketio-chat

Socket.IO Chat with NodeJS + Mysql (Room Supported)

html mysql node node-js socket socket-io

Last synced: 14 Apr 2025

https://github.com/rtamizh/realtime-push

Real-time push notification package for laravel

laravel laravel-package notifications php realtime socket-io

Last synced: 23 Apr 2025

https://github.com/timekadel/lazy

A Node.js API framework made by lazy developers for lazy developers.

api database easy-to-use fast javascript modern mysql open-source orm rest-api socket-io test-automation testing

Last synced: 15 Jul 2025

https://github.com/jaayperez/node-chat-app

Real-time chat app built with MongoDB, Express, and Node.js.

bluebird body-parser chat chat-application express mongodb node nodejs realtime-chat socket-io

Last synced: 09 Oct 2025

https://github.com/EnginKARATAS/dogecoin-advanced

Dogecoin game playing in web browser with multiplayer. The game have a score counter boarder. This repo made by javascript and p5 library.

dogecoin game javascript p5js p5js-game socket socket-io

Last synced: 08 Sep 2025

https://github.com/emadehsan/chat-room

Real time chat client with SocketIO, ExpressJS, MongoDB

express mongodb mongoose nodejs realtime-chat socket-io vuejs

Last synced: 07 Apr 2026

https://github.com/devlaiger/webrtc-nodejs-video-call

A conference call implementation using WebRTC, Socket.io and Node.js

chat-application javascript nodejs socket-io video-call webrtc

Last synced: 10 Oct 2025

https://github.com/evelynhathaway/triton-poll

👩‍⚖️🗳 Live virtual voting and placard rasing for Model United Nations conferences

model-united-nations nodejs react socket-io

Last synced: 07 Oct 2025

https://github.com/anav5704/scalable-chat

Real time scaleable chat app

redis socket-io turborepo

Last synced: 15 Apr 2025

https://github.com/mohit-nagaraj/wechat

A real-time chat application (better features :D) using Socket.IO, Express, and MongoDB with HTTPS support. It manages user connections and messages securely.

aws context-api expressjs github-actions mongodb nodejs rest-api socket-io tailwindcss vitejs

Last synced: 07 May 2025

https://github.com/vinne01/chess

This chess game platform is designed to offer an enjoyable and interactive experience for chess enthusiasts, combining modern web technologies like Node.js, Express.js, and Socket.IO to create a smooth, real-time multiplayer environment for players to connect, play, and improve their chess skills.

ejs-templates express-js nodejs socket-io

Last synced: 03 Jul 2025

https://github.com/oguzhan18/quick-note-manger

Quick Temporary Note Taker Full Stack Note Production Application

angular api backend frontend ngrx nodejs notes socket-io

Last synced: 13 Feb 2026

Socket.IO Awesome Lists
Socket.IO Categories